Muangthanhinius siami Marivaux et al. 2006 (primate)

Mammalia - Primates - Ekgmowechashalidae

Full reference: L. Marivaux, Y. Chaimanee, P. Tafforeau and J.-J. Jaeger. 2006. New strepsirrhine primate from the late Eocene of peninsular Thailand (Krabi Basin). American Journal of Physical Anthropology 130:425-434

Belongs to Muangthanhinius according to L. Marivaux et al. 2006

Sister taxa: none

Type specimen: TF 6212, a mandible. Its type locality is Bang Mark Lignite Mine, which is in an Eocene fluvial-lacustrine lignite in Thailand.

Ecology: arboreal omnivore

Distribution: found only at Bang Mark Lignite Mine
